ESI IVX E-Class Phone System

The patented ESI IVX E-Class design means all vital business communications features you need are built in -- not added on.  The IVX E-Class includes:

bulletA highly advanced, expandable phone system with extensive and unique call-handling features
bulletA superior-quality voice mail system with exceptional features and messaging options
bulletA multi-level, highly customizable automated attendant for call routing
bullet

Automated call distribution to maximize your callers' convenience

bulletOptional VoIP Telephony to connect remote locations as one system

Grows with your business -- intelligently

Whether you have many outside lines and large numbers of users or just a handful of each, IVX's modular, flexible design grows with your business.  The IVX E-Class supports up to 66 phone lines and up to 84 ESI Feature Phones.  As your communications needs grow, you can easily and inexpensively add lines (including high-capacity broadband), phones and special options if and when you need them.

Help at the press of a key

ESI's comprehensive Verbal Users Guide™ makes IVX the easiest business phone system you have ever used.  Just press the HELP key and the interactive, Verbal User's Guide even provides a complete tutorial -- along with a friendly "Good morning."

Built-in voice mail

Improve your business communication with ESI's integrated voice mail.  Easily accessible by using the distinctive blue VOICE MAIL key on the Digital Feature Phone, ESI's fifth-generation technology offers up to 16 simultaneously available channels of voice mail -- as well as more than 200 mailboxes and up to 280 hours of voice message storage.  With ESI's exclusive Virtual Mailbox™and other unique features, you can easily customize IVX's voice mail for your special applications.
